Elizabeth, a 4-syllable girl's name of Hebrew origin, means: Gods oath; dedicated. The ethnic backgrounds of Elizabeth include , Scottish , English/Welsh . It's religious association is biblical (see * Mt 3:1).Entertainers with this name include , Elizabeth Taylor (Movies) , Elizabeth Seal (Stage) . Historical figures with this name include , Elizabeth Barrett Browning (Art) , Elizabeth (Royalty) , Elizabeth (World Leaders) . It has religious backgrounds in , Biblical , Saints .

Tessa, a 2-syllable girl's name of Greek origin, means: Reaper; born-fourth.
